“…In Turkey mainly two species, L. angustifolia and L. stoechas and their subspecies and hybrid forms grow wildly or they are cultivated (Davis 1982;Gören et al 2002). L. stoechas is known as French lavender (Hsu et al 2007) and it is used by people for various diseases of central nervous system (epilepsy and migraine), treatment of wounds, reduce to blood sugar. It is also used as antispasmodic, antiseptic, antimicrobial, sedative, diuretic and analgesic agens (Gamez et al 1987;Baytop 1999;Gilani et al 2000).…”
